Is a blue wave even possible? A way too early look at the midterm elections

More than 460 days away, next year’s midterm elections are approaching, but Democrats are looking hopefully toward the past. The president’s party has lost House seats in all but two midterm elections since 1938. Gas prices: Remain steady through the last week of July

The national average price for regular gas on Wednesday is $3.14 per gallon.  It is a price point that has remained steady throughout the country the last week of July. DOJ confirms only law enforcement testified in Epstein, Maxwell grand juries

The Justice Department revealed late Tuesday that only law enforcement witnesses were called before the grand juries that indicted Jeffrey Epstein and Ghislaine Maxwell.
